Toyota Corolla Cross GR-S brings sportiness to the range

Toyota introduces the Corolla Cross GR-S in SA, blending sporty styling, tuned suspension, and hybrid efficiency with everyday practicality.

Toyota has expanded its local Corolla Cross line-up with the GR-S, a variant that injects sport-inspired styling and sharper driving dynamics.

Building on the established strengths of the Corolla Cross, it introduces distinctive exterior cues, GR-branded interior finishes, and suspension tuning that set it apart from the rest of the range.

The GR-S stands out with a black mesh grille, LED headlamps with sequential indicators, sculpted skid plates, and 18-inch alloy wheels, complemented by bi-tone paint options such as Glacier White, Chromium Silver, and Arizona Red with a black roof.

Inside, black leather with red stitching, GR logos, red seatbelts, and aluminium sports pedals create a performance-focused atmosphere, supported by advanced tech including a 10.1-inch audio display, 12.3-inch digital cluster, panoramic view monitor, and a power back door with kick sensor.

Performance comes from the familiar 1.8-litre petrol engine producing 103kW and 172Nm, or a hybrid system delivering 90kW, both paired with a CVT gearbox. Paddle shifters on the petrol version and revised suspension enhance driver engagement while maintaining efficiency.

Pricing places the GR-S at R527 000 and the GR-S HEV at R569 700, positioning it as a sporty yet practical addition to the Corolla Cross family.
